Output fda87dd3cd03c99cd9bcc8aa9f6af7f789e81f7f25917536ca99b70656a93b18:1

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3b94f52280a86e3f6085b010d6da2a29362dfb OP_EQUAL
address
32tz5rj2Yv1xtvWbh6fKfdHXNnvdwDZT7c
transaction
fda87dd3cd03c99cd9bcc8aa9f6af7f789e81f7f25917536ca99b70656a93b18
confirmations
375959
spent
true